ec-validator-dni
Version:
Validation of Ecuadorian identification documents (ID card and RUC)
55 lines (46 loc) • 1.03 kB
text/typescript
export const VALID_DNI: string [] = [
'0105566046',
'0105566038',
'0942362856',
];
export const INVALID_DNI: string [] = [
'0105566046001',
'0105566',
'010556604A',
];
export const VALID_RUC: string [] = [
'0105566046001',
'0105566038001',
'0942362856001',
];
export const INVALID_RUC: string [] = [
'010556604A001',
'0105566',
'010556604A',
];
export const VALID_RUC_SOCIETY_PRIVATE: string [] = [
'0992256230001',
'1790450635001',
];
export const INVALID_RUC_SOCIETY_PRIVATE: string [] = [
'0992256234001',
'1790450637001',
];
export const VALID_RUC_PUBLIC_SOCIETY: string [] = [
'1760004650001',
'1760001120001',
];
export const INVALID_RUC_PUBLIC_SOCIETY: string [] = [
'1760004680001',
'1760001110001',
];
export const VALID_ANY_RUC: string [] = [
'0105566046001',
'1760004650001',
'0992256230001',
];
export const INVALID_ANY_RUC: string [] = [
'0105566001',
'1760004611001',
'0992256223001',
];